    Default L2a1c or L2a1c6 mtDNA???

    Hello everyone,
    Some months ago I tested my DNA using 23andme and I got L2a1c as my mtDNA haplotype. However, I kept digging a bit more about this (I was so curious) and recently I tried the James Lick mtDNA Haplogroup Analysis and I got a different result, L2a1c6.
    After having a look on the results from James Lick mtDNA analysis, I think I found the potential reason of this discrepancy (but not 100% sure). It seems to me that my mtDNA have markers for the subtype L2a1c6 but lacks one of the previous defining markers (16086C) used to move from L2a1c to L2a1c6 and that theoretically L2a1c6 must have....
